26396076347 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 26396076348. Its totient is φ = 26396076346.
The previous prime is 26396076313. The next prime is 26396076349. The reversal of 26396076347 is 74367069362.
It is a strong prime.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 26396076347 - 210 = 26396075323 is a prime.
Together with 26396076349, it forms a pair of twin primes.
It is a Chen prime.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(26396076349)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 13198038173 + 13198038174.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(13198038174).
Almost surely, 226396076347 is an apocalyptic number.
26396076347 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
26396076347 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
26396076347 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 6858432, while the sum is 53.
The spelling of 26396076347 in words is "twenty-six billion, three hundred ninety-six million, seventy-six thousand, three hundred forty-seven".
